The SICK LMS111-10100 is a professional-grade 2D LiDAR (Light Detection and Ranging) sensor designed for long-range measurement and area monitoring. It scans its surrounding environment in a single plane (up to 270°) by measuring the time-of-flight of laser beams, creating a detailed "point cloud" used for localization, mapping, and collision avoidance in automated systems.
The ifm ISD4000-6111 is an inductive proximity sensor from the ISD4000 series. It is designed for non-contact detection of metallic objects (like machine parts, targets, or clamps) and is particularly valued in hydraulic applications for piston detection in cylinders due to its pressure-resistant design.
The SICK DL100-21AA2102 is a small, self-contained retro-reflective photoelectric sensor. It detects an object when it interrupts the light beam between the sensor and a dedicated reflector. Its compact plastic housing and fixed cable make it a cost-effective solution for basic object detection in limited spaces.
The SICK WL27-3P2430 is a self-contained, long-range background suppression photoelectric sensor. It uses advanced technology to detect objects only within a precisely defined switching range, ignoring anything beyond it, making it highly reliable for position detection and object counting even with highly reflective backgrounds.
